  • Whistler expected to get up to 20 cm of snow overnight

    Good news for all the ski bums, or anyone who is longing for winter.

    Snowfall is expected tonight for Whistler of up to 20 cm.

    According to Environment Canada, a strong Pacific frontal system has stalled over the south coast this afternoon.

    The system, in combination with temperatures near freezing in the Whistler Valley, has resulted in rapid accumulation of snow.

    The front will move out of the area this evening, but not before depositing a total accumulation of 15 to 20 cm of snow.

    Overnight temperatures will continue to hover near or just above freezing. The unstable airmass moving into the south coast tonight could produce a further 5 cm by Thursday morning.

    Some local hills, like Big White, have already had some snowfall recently, getting everyone excited for ski season.
